December has arrived, which means that it is the time of Advent and Christmas. As the darkness settles over each day earlier and earlier, this is a time when moments with hot chocolate, candles, fireplaces, and loved ones have the power to warm our hearts and feed our spirits. Know that I am grateful for all of you this Christmas season and look forward to celebrating the beautiful and curious story of Jesus birth with you all. Speaking of Jesus birth, did you know that the Gospel of Mark and the Gospel of John never mention it? Only the Gospel of Matthew and Luke do. Did you know that in the Gospel of Matthew, Jesus is seemingly born in a house (Matthew 2:11) and, in the Gospel of Luke, Jesus is born in a manger? Or lastly, did you know that the three wise men only show up in the Gospel of Matthews version of Jesus birth, and the shepherds and angels only show up in Lukes version? Why dont the writers of Mark and John tell a birth story? Why do Matthew and Lukes stories differ? There are many interesting and important details like this in scripture of which many of us are not aware. One of my preaching professors, David Lose, tells a story about a time when he was listening to We Wish You A Merry Christmas, a carol so many of us know so well. He was singing along on the second verseOh, bring us some figgy pudding. Oh, bring us some figgy pudding. Oh, bring us some figgy pudding and a cup of good cheerand suddenly, it dawned on him what the heck is figgy pudding? It is a song he has sung hundreds of times in his life and he had never wondered (or asked!) what figgy pudding was. What is worse is that it never bothered him that he didnt know what it was. Every Sunday, we hear four Scripture readings and I wonder how many of us really understand what is being said and what it means (myself included!). Or is it just like this Christmas carol and figgy pudding we are so used to listening to these scripture readings and it doesnt bother us that we dont understand them. Do we know the Christian story anymore and do we know those important and meaningful details? As a way of deepening our faith and exploring the Bible, Id like to offer a discussion group in January based on David Loses book, Making Sense of Scripture: Big Questions About the Book of Faith. In this book, Lose invites us to engage in a conversation, one that he imagines discussing around his kitchen table, about seven major questions of the Bible. This book and discussion series has been widely successful among Christian churches nationwide. It is a dialogue that encourages us to bring our questions or doubts to the table when reading Scripture. Please stay tuned during the month of December for dates/times and sign-ups. Advent blessings and love to you all, Pastor Jon P.S. For those of you still wondering: figgy pudding is a white pudding made of figs, which was traditionally served to carolers.
